Saundersfoot Pubs : The Old Chemist Inn pub in Saundersfoot
'Possibly the best pub in town. Cosmopolitan customers of all ages. Good public bar. Slightly cafe-type lounge but serving fantastic (and huge) Sunday lunches. Good ales. Beach view and terrace with beach access.'
